Industrial-Grade Submerged Arc Power Source

The ESAB LAF 1251 is a premier three-phase, fan-cooled DC welding power source engineered specifically for high-efficiency automated submerged arc welding (SAW) and high-productivity Gas Metal Arc Welding (MIG/MAG). Designed to meet the rigorous demands of heavy industry, this unit (SKU: 0460514880) operates on a 440/550V 3-phase input, making it suitable for specific industrial grids often found in heavy manufacturing sectors. The machine utilizes advanced thyristor control technology to deliver exceptional arc characteristics, ensuring smooth starts and stable operation across the entire current range.

One of the defining technical advantages of the LAF 1251 is its impressive duty cycle. Rated at 100% duty cycle at 1250 Amps, this power source is built for continuous, non-stop operation, eliminating downtime due to thermal overload in high-volume production environments. It features built-in voltage compensation, which actively monitors and adjusts for mains voltage fluctuations, ensuring that the welding parameters remain constant and the weld quality remains uniform. This is critical in automated applications where consistency is paramount.

Integration is seamless with ESAB's ecosystem of automation equipment. The LAF 1251 is fully compatible with the A2 and A6 process controllers, such as the PEK and PEI systems. This connectivity allows for sophisticated control over welding parameters, including pre-setting and remote adjustment, facilitating complex automated setups for beam welding, pipe mills, and tank fabrication. The unit's robust chassis is designed to withstand harsh industrial environments, ensuring longevity and reliability even in dusty or rugged conditions.

Key Technical Specifications:

  • Input Voltage: 440/550V, 3-Phase, 60Hz
  • Output Range: Optimized for high-current applications up to 1250A
  • Duty Cycle: 100% at 1250A / 44V
  • Process Compatibility: Submerged Arc (SAW), MIG/MAG
  • Cooling: Forced Air (Fan Cooled)
  • Communication: Analog/Digital interface for ESAB controllers

APPLICATIONS

  • Wind Energy: Manufacturing of wind tower sections and foundations.
  • Pressure Vessels: Longitudinal and circumferential seam welding of heavy-wall tanks.
  • Shipbuilding: Panel lines and hull fabrication.
  • Pipe Mills: Spiral and longitudinal pipe welding.
  • Bridge Construction: Heavy structural beam fabrication.
  • General Heavy Fabrication: Earthmoving equipment and mining machinery components.
